well a couple of things to keep in mind here,
1) dead money was announced roughly a week before new vegas was even released (October 19) and that took 2 months before it was available for download
2) after dead money was released on xbox on December 23? it took 2 months for it to be released on comp and ps (feb 22)
3) all dlcs are being released simeltaneously across all consoles from now on

so the point you can take from what im saying is that if it took 2 months for dead money to be released on xbox and another 2 months for it to be released on other platforms it might take 4-6 months (since speculation says it will be a whole new area, which means has more content and takes alot longer to develop) before the game is actually ready for release.
